Building Maintenance Superintendent (4595-39)
Deadline to Apply:
Open Until Filled
Work Location:
River City Correctional Center
3220 Colerain Avenue
Cincinnati, OH 45225
Work Hours:
80 Hours Bi-Weekly
Starting Salary:
$ 28.00 an hour

Requirements (Education, Experience, Licensure, Certification):
  • High School Diploma or General Equivalency Diploma.
  • 3 years’ experience in building maintenance with demonstrated ability to perform job description.
  • Possession of a valid Ohio Operator’s Permit.
Job Duties (Summary):
  • Performs maintenance and repairs of residential facility.
  • Can perform the following unsupervised: plumbing to include fixing leaks, changing toilets, sinks, faucets, unclogging drains. Repair electrical outlets replace ballast, change light, build and frame walls, drywall, finish and paint at professional level.
  • Operates truck or other vehicles to pick up and deliver parts, supplies, materials or refuse; loads and unloads materials to and from vehicles.
  • Maintains and inventories tools and supplies.
  • Perform preventive maintenance on industrial and residential washer, dryer, and generator.
  • Knowledge of industrial kitchen equipment repair and preventive maintenance.
  • Performs repairs on tools and equipment, maintains grounds of facility, performs custodial duties as needed (e.g., furniture, equipment and appliance repair, cleaning, mopping, sweeping and waxing floors, mowing lawn, empties trash, shoveling snow, spreads salt, etc.)
  • Supervises all maintenance workers (e.g., all maintenance repair workers) or equipment operation workers (e.g., equipment operators) &/or miscellaneous maintenance workers (e.g., movers, laborers) engaged in general maintenance or general building maintenance, alteration &/or repair.
  • Estimates repair, time and labor &/or remodeling costs; prepares specifications & obtain bids; monitors contracts & agreements.
  • Inspects completed projects for approval &/or disapproval and prepares progress reports on building & maintenance projects.
  • Routinely inspects buildings, grounds and equipment to determine condition and to ensure compliance with applicable state & local building regulations and accrediting bodies.
  • Maintains inventory control of fixed assets, equipment, supplies & materials for all department maintenance repair; approves &/or disapproves work orders; requisitions supplies, materials & equipment.
  • Prepares & submits reports of work performed & materials used; maintains files, records and all documentation required for maintenance department; and
  • Attend staff meetings when required.
  • On call as needed for emergency.

Positions Supervised
Maintenance Department and all maintenance workers and associated residents.

Knowledge, Skills and Abilities
  • Skills in building maintenance (electrical, plumbing, carpentry, refrigeration, heating, welding, inventory control, custodial methods).
  • Skill in the use of various hand and power tools.
  • Ability to read and understand a variety of technical manuals.
  • Ability to calculate fractions, decimals, and percentages.
  • Ability to maintain accurate records.
  • Ability to discern, diagnose and repair equipment or structural damage.
  • Ability to remain calm in tense situations.
  • Visual ability sufficient to effectively operate office equipment including calculator, copier, facsimile machine and computer.
  • Ability to read and prepare reports with recommendations, correspondence, instructions, policies and procedures.
  • Hearing ability sufficient to hold conversation with other individuals both in person and over a telephone.
  • Speaking ability sufficient to communicate effectively with other individuals in person and over a telephone.
  • Skills in oral and written communication.
  • Visual ability to read and prepare reports.
  • Ability to supervise and direct the work of maintenance staff.
  • Ability to train and schedule residents working in the Maintenance Assistance Program (MAP).
  • Knowledge of basic computer skills and ability to create a schedule for the Maintenance Assistance Program (MAP); and
  • Ability to work with vendors, contractors, and order supplies while keeping the facility supply inventory.

Working Conditions
Correctional facility setting and outdoor premises.

Physical Demands
Ability to perform moderate to heavy labor. Ability to transfer up to 50 pounds.

Communications
Conveys and receives information in person, over the telephone and on a portable handheld radio.
